Hello.
So I have several tabs open, leading to different folders on my computer. No matter which tab I am in, if I hit Ctrl-F, the search location is always the same. Is there a way to make the location default to the current location in the TAB? Is there a fast keyboard shortcut to paste the current location into the location box?

Thanks for your help.

Did you uncheck the [x] Auto sync feature under Name & Location (in the search tabs)?
